Values are resistance in ohm for temperature + * range from -10 to 80C with +/-1C tolerance. + * @note This table is derived based on the look-up table specified + * in the datasheet of KY81/110 part. The linear interpolation + * has been used to obtain 1C step size. +**/ +const uint32_t ptc_ky81_110::lut[] = { + 747, 753, 760, 767, 774, 781, 787, 794, 801, 808, 815, 822, 829, 836, + 843, 850, 857, 864, 871, 878, 886, 893, 901, 908, 916, 923, 931, 938, + 946, 953, 961, 968, 976, 984, 992, 1000, 1008, 1016, 1024, 1032, 1040, + 1048, 1056, 1064, 1072, 1081, 1089, 1097, 1105, 1113, 1122, 1130, 1139, + 1148, 1156, 1165, 1174, 1182, 1191, 1200, 1209, 1218, 1227, 1236, 1245, + 1254, 1263, 1272, 1281, 1290, 1299, 1308, 1317, 1326, 1336, 1345, 1354, + 1364, 1373, 1382, 1392, 1401, 1411, 1421, 1431, 1441, 1450, 1460, 1470, + 1480, 1490 +}; +#endif + + +/*! + * @brief This is a constructor for ptc_ky81_110 class + * @return none + */ +ptc_ky81_110::ptc_ky81_110() +{ + temperature_coeff = 0.79; /* Temperature coefficient for KY81/110 */ + +#ifdef DEFINE_LOOKUP_TABLES + ptc_ky81_110::lut_offset = -10; /* Min temperature obtained through LUT */ + ptc_ky81_110::lut_size = 90; /* Temperature range defined in LUT + [lut_offset : lut_size - lut_offset] */ +#endif +} + + +/*! + * @brief Convert the thermistor resistance into equivalent temperature + * @param resistance[in] - thermistor resistance + * @return Thermistor temperature value + * @note Resistance at room temperature is 1000 ohms (1K) + */ +float ptc_ky81_110::convert(const float resistance) +{ + return (((resistance - 1000) / 1000) * (100.0 / temperature_coeff)) + 25.0; +} + + +#ifdef DEFINE_LOOKUP_TABLES +/*! + * @brief Convert the thermistor resistance into equivalent temperature using + * lookup table for KY81/110 NTC + * @param resistance[in] - thermistor resistance + * @return Thermistor temperature value + */ +float ptc_ky81_110::lookup(const float resistance) +{ + return thermistor::lookup(lut, resistance, lut_size, lut_offset); +} +#endif +
